Based on the novel The Dark Fields, Bradley Cooper and Robert De Niro team up in a paranoia-fueled thriller about a miraculous clear pill that makes you smarter, faster, and even more charismatic. Basically a real life Bradley Copper. In theaters March 18, 2011.
Blake Freeman takes Leroy, a 69-year-old man who has spent his life savings trying to protect himself from extraterrestrials and the paranormal, on a journey across the country to uncover the truth about aliens, psychics, and ghosts. Why does he have two noses? In theaters Spring 2011.
